As nouns, placidity is a hypernym of ataraxia; that is, placidity is a word with a broader meaning than ataraxia:
  • ataraxia: peace of mind
  • placidity: a disposition free from stress or emotion
Other hypernyms of ataraxia include quiet, repose, serenity, tranquility, tranquillity.
